Tema: TRIGER duda
Ver Mensaje Individual
  #9 (permalink)  
Antiguo 28/05/2009, 17:01
Avatar de iislas
i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 17 años, 5 meses
Puntos: 180
Respuesta: TRIGER duda

Dradi7

¿Que crees?

Que NO, el trigger se dispara 1 vez y en la tabla de paso almacena los 10, 20, 50, 10,000, 300,000 registros.....

Por eso mi afirmacion, lean su AYUDA EN LINEA....please.....

Si yo hago un

DELETE CLIENTE WHERE Tipo_Cliente = 1

Y se borran 10,000 registros y tengo un trigger que me pase eso a un historico de clientes borrados, el trigger se veria asi.


CREATE TRIGGER trg_DeleteCliente
ON CLIENTE
FOR DELETE
AS
INSERT INTO CLIENTE_HISTORICO
SELECT * FROM DELETED

Este me copiara los 10,000 registros borrados...........

Saludos